Service Level Agreement Template Graphic Design

When it comes to outsourcing your graphic design needs, it`s important to establish a service level agreement (SLA) with your chosen provider. A service level agreement is a document that outlines the expectations and responsibilities of both parties involved in a service arrangement. In the case of graphic design, an SLA will ensure that your designer produces work that meets your standards and is delivered on time.

Creating an SLA may seem like a tedious task, but it`s a crucial one. Without an SLA, you risk miscommunications, misunderstandings, delays, and unsatisfactory results. Fortunately, there are service level agreement templates available that you can customize to suit your specific needs.

A service level agreement template for graphic design should include the following:

1. Scope of work: Clearly define the projects that the designer will be working on. This can be broken down by design deliverables, such as flyers, brochures, logos, websites, or any other design work that your business requires.

2. Timeline: Set a timeframe for when the designer will deliver each project. This should include specific dates for each milestone, such as the initial concepts, revisions, and final delivery.

3. Revisions: Establish the number of revisions that the designer will provide for each project. It`s important to balance your need for quality work with the designer`s need to manage their workload.

4. Communication: Outline how you and the designer will communicate throughout the project. This can include email, phone calls, or meetings. Be sure to specify how often you will check in with the designer to ensure that the project is on track.

5. Payment: Set the payment terms for the project. This should include the payment schedule, the total amount, and any additional fees or costs.
